alpine and sweetex are the most common brands.
Once you have tasted and worked with hi ratio, you will never go back to crisco! Believe me! I use Crisco for things like greasing my pans and stuff like that...but for buttercream, its just too greeezy.
I always use the Wilton's whitener, not just because of the color....it gives the buttercream a different texture that I like. It seems to pipe better and crust better for me.
I found that "Land O Lakes" butter has the whitest color to it when trying to achieve whiter butter cream icing, and then if need be I use a smidgeon of Wiltons whitener as well
